San Jacinto, California – Actress Robyn Bernard, known for her role in the soap opera “General Hospital,” was discovered deceased in an open field this week, as reported by the Riverside County Sheriff’s Department. Bernard’s tragic passing shed light on her journey from the heights of her acting career to a life marked by struggles and possible homelessness.

During the 1980s, Bernard garnered fame for her portrayal of singer Terry Brock in “General Hospital,” appearing in 145 episodes and residing in Malibu. However, as her acting career waned, she found herself living in a mobile home far from Los Angeles, disconnected from her former fan base. Eric Ackerman, a member of the General Hospital Fan Club, noted that Bernard had distanced herself from fan events and reunions in recent years.

Despite attempts to reconnect with Bernard, it was revealed that she had faced hardships, including a fire at a trailer park, which impacted her ability to participate in events. Reports indicated that Bernard had reunited with her father and actress sister Crystal Bernard in Glendale after the fire, providing some solace in tumultuous times.

Local news sources in San Jacinto unveiled Bernard’s stark reality of possibly being homeless, depicting her as a familiar figure in the community. Comments from locals reflected fond memories of Bernard, showcasing her as a kind individual who touched the lives of those around her.

The circumstances surrounding Bernard’s death remain unclear, as the coroner has yet to determine a cause.
